@jpelgrom Read here real quick https://developer.android.com/jetpack/compose/tooling/previews#preview-viewmodel
"If you want to preview a composable that uses a ViewModel, you should create another composable with the parameters from ViewModel passed as arguments of the composable. This way, you don't need to preview the composable that uses the ViewModel."
